Beyoncé is kicking things off the right way in 2013. After just getting wind of her forthcoming GQ cover, now we receive word that Bey and her Destiny’s Child crew will be releasing a new project. It’s been eight years since the female trio last dropped off Destiny Fulfilled, as the upcoming compilation, Love Songs, will only feature one completely new track. Titled “Nuclear,” the cut was rumored to have been produced and co-written by Pharrell. But until we receive additional info on the single as well as the work in general, you can take a peek at the coinciding tracklist below.
